Dame Restaurant has launched the innovative NFT VIP membership

In the exotic and mysterious land of USA, a popular seafood restaurant has started experimenting with NFT VIP membership. As a result, the normally calm and collected state of Twitter is drawing the ire.

In its latest marketing campaign, Dame Restaurant in New York City collaborated with Front of the Front. House NFT platform A $1000 non-fungible token that provides exclusive ‘skip the line’ benefits. As a result, those who know NFT can queue up in its table booking system by presenting their ‘Affable Hospitality Club’ token.

Although VIP membership dates back at least to the ancient Egyptians, Twitter went berserk at the inclusion of NFTs. Hence, his now predictable outrage response with statements like ‘Restaurant reservation culture has gone too far’ and ‘QR code is worse than a menu’ (which it definitely isn’t).

everything, Dame Currently only 20 of the popular NFTs have been introduced, of which 11 are available. According to sources, the platform will split revenue 80/20 between the restaurant and the marketplace.
